Twin brothers, Billy and Bobby, can mow their grandparent's lawn together in 61 minutes. Billy could mow the lawn by himself in 21 minutes less time that it would take Bobby. How long would it take Bobby to mow the lawn by himself?

Answer provided by our tutors

let


x = the minutes Billy needs to mow the lawn alone, x > 0

y = the minutes Bob needs to mow the lawn alone, y > 0


Billy could mow the lawn by himself in 21 minutes less time that it would take Bobby


x = y - 21


together they can mow their grandparent's lawn in 61 minutes


the rate of Billy (1 lawn in x min) + rate of Bobby (1 lawn in y min) = the together rate (1 lawn in 61 min)


1/x + 1/y = 1/61


plug x = y - 21 into the last equation


1/(y - 21) + 1/y = 1/61


by solving we find 2 roots


y1 = 133.4 min


y2 = 9.6 min


y2 = 9.6 min is not the solution since for y2 = 9.6 min we have x = 9.6 - 21 < 0 and that is not possible (we need x to be positive)

It would take 133.4 min for Bobby to mow the lawn by himself.
